About this role
Intel is seeking a Sales Development Manager for the APJ region to grow cloud consumption revenue with leading global Cloud Service Providers and their customers. The role sits on the Global Accounts Team, reporting to the GM of Global Accounts (APJ), and focuses on aligning regional and HQ efforts to execute joint go-to-market strategies. The position is a commissioned sales role centered on strategic engagement with major CSP partners across APJ.

About Intel
intel.comIntel Corporation is a global technology company that designs and manufactures advanced integrated digital technology products, including microprocessors, chipsets, and software solutions. With a focus on delivering Artificial Intelligence (AI) at scale, Intel provides comprehensive hardware and software solutions for cloud, data center, edge computing, and client devices. The company is known for its innovation in technologies that power a variety of computing platforms, from personal computers to enterprise solutions, enabling businesses and individuals to realize their full potential.
